POM Material Properties
Property | Unit | Test Method | Homopolymer | Copolymer |
|---|---|---|---|---|
Specific Gravity | — | D792 | 1.42 | 1.41 |
Tensile Strength | MPa | D638 | 75 | 62 |
Elongation at Break | % | D638 | 30 | 50 |
Impact Strength (Izod, Notched) | J/m | D256 | 80 | 100 |
Hardness (Rockwell) | — | D785 | R120 | R115 |
Coefficient of Linear Thermal Expansion | ×10⁻⁵/°C | D696 | 9 | 10 |
Continuous Service Temperature | °C | — | 90 | 90 |
Volume Resistivity | Ω·cm | D257 | 6×10¹² | 6×10¹² |
Dielectric Strength | KV/mm | D149 | 13–15 | 20 |
Overview of POM
POM (polyoxymethylene) is an engineering plastic recognized for its excellent mechanical strength, wear resistance, and chemical resistance. It machines cleanly with minimal burring—and any burrs that form are easy to remove—making it a great fit for precision components.
POM is also highly resistant to moisture absorption, which means it experiences very little dimensional change due to water or humidity uptake. It's an extremely versatile material and, alongside MC Nylon, is one of the most frequently considered options when selecting a plastic for machined parts.

Material Selection Considerations
Standard-grade POM has poor weather resistance and is not suitable for outdoor applications. While it is slow-burning, its oxygen index of 15 means it is still flammable, so it should not be used in environments with open flames or significant heat sources.
Although POM generally has low water absorption, some grades can actually absorb more moisture than expected. For example, the high-load sliding grade POM SW-01 has a water absorption rate of 0.6%, while the MC Nylon sliding grade MC703HL sits at 0.5% — meaning the POM grade absorbs slightly more in this case.
Since physical properties can vary between grades, always consult the latest material data sheet from the manufacturer when finalizing your material selection. This will help ensure the best possible match for your specific application.
